Who doesn't loooove zucchiniiiiiiis? I never ate it raw before but The Fat Kid Inside made this super simple "Zucchini Fix" wherein he super thinly sliced it, drizzled it with olive oil, some salt and A LOT OF pepper to taste(HAHA, right guys?), and some lemon juice for that tangy flavor!

Well, until that day. HAHAH. I didn't know that we could actually make chicken skewers using lemongrass(tanglad).

Just freeze some bananas, grab some almond milk(or whatever non dairy milk that you have), some coconut cream...
Put them all in a mixer/blender/pulser or whatever tool you have in your kitchen and
